Bonjour,
je fais ceci:
ce qui me donne ce résultat: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7 for (int d=0; d<tabPrenomP.length;d++){ if(tabPrenomP[0][d] != null || tabPrenomP[1][d]!=null){//si l'une des cellules n'est pas null //afficher l'agent + la validation System.out.println("Agent: "+tabPrenomP[0][d]+" heures: "+tabheures[1][d]+" semaine: "+semaineP[1][d]); } }
J'aimerais relevé: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28 Agent: CAMILLE heures: 10.5 semaine: 1 Agent: MURIELLE heures: 2.5 semaine: 1 Agent: ISABELLE heures: 1.0 semaine: 1 Agent: OPHÉLIE heures: 3.0 semaine: 1 Agent: LAURA heures: 3.5 semaine: 1 Agent: ASSMA heures: 10.25 semaine: 1 Agent: CAMILLE heures: 4.75 semaine: 2 Agent: MURIELLE heures: 7.5 semaine: 2 Agent: ASSMA heures: 5.25 semaine: 2 Agent: YOANN heures: 4.5 semaine: 2 Agent: ADELINE heures: 4.0 semaine: 2 Agent: YVANE heures: 0.75 semaine: 3 Agent: MURIELLE heures: 8.75 semaine: 3 Agent: ISABELLE heures: 1.0 semaine: 3 Agent: OPHÉLIE heures: 1.5 semaine: 3 Agent: PAULE heures: 4.5 semaine: 3 Agent: YOANN heures: 10.75 semaine: 3 Agent: ADELINE heures: 8.25 semaine: 3 Agent: YVANE heures: 9.25 semaine: 4 Agent: VALÉRIE heures: 2.0 semaine: 4 Agent: MURIELLE heures: 16.75 semaine: 4 Agent: ISABELLE heures: 9.25 semaine: 4 Agent: OPHÉLIE heures: 7.25 semaine: 4 Agent: LAURA heures: 2.25 semaine: 4 Agent: PAULE heures: 13.25 semaine: 4 Agent: YOANN heures: 19.25 semaine: 4 Agent: ADELINE heures: 20.0 semaine: 4
- le nombre de fois que je rencontre 1 pour semaineP[1][d],
- le nombre de fois que je rencontre 2 pour semaineP[1][d],
etc... etc..
Pour les 52 semaines de l'année.
Y'a-t-il un autre moyen de faire en évitant de faire:
if(semaineP[1][d]==1) nbdefoissemaine1++
Merci
Partager